Disease/Disorder Poster 
Grab Posterboard must be 1/2 to full size. Choose one that is appropriate for your project. The poster should be decorated to represent your assigned subject visually. On the poster, you should have at least 3 pictures, drawings, graphs, charts, etc. that represent your assigned subject and will be your discussion points. Remember, I do not grade whether or not you are a "good" artist. I look at your EFFORT.

Poster Appearance
4 pts

Must be decorated using effort. It should give a visual representation of your subject f using picture/art and written word.

Poor

The poster shows little or no effort. Sloppy presentation.
Fair

The poster had limited information and was poorly organized.
Good

The poster contained information but was cluttered/ visibly confusing/distracting
Effective

The poster contained all required information and was clearly visible. Content was displayed in a organized, logical manner. Grabs viewers attention.
Items on the poster
4 pts

At least 3 items and symbols representing your assigned subject. It must be a visual representation of the disease/disorder, prevention, and/or treatment.

Poor

No items were on the poster.
Fair

1-2 items were on the poster and connected to the subject. Not displayed in an attractive manner
Good

2-3 items were on the poster and connected to the subject.
Effective

3 or more items that provide good visual representation of the assigned subject content. Is relevant to the purpose of the poster.
Presentation
4 pts

Speech Length should be between 2-3 min. Each prop will be presented and how it relates to the subject

Poor

Did not speak
Fair

0-1:00
Good

1:00-2:00
Effective

2:00-3:00
Content
4 pts

Your presentation must include:
*Name of disease/disorder
*Cause
*Sign and Symptoms
*Prevention if applicable
*Treatment cite sources

Poor

No research is evident. Unable to answer any questions about the subject. No sources
Fair

Minimum information delivered. Able to answer basic questions using information sheet. Only source cited is textbook/powerpoint
Good

Knowledgeable of content. Able to answer questions with minimal help from information sheet. Cites only text book/powerpoint
Effective

Very knowledgeable about subject. Able to answer relevant questions. Could answer questions without use of information sheet. Cites 3 sources
